Similarly, it is asked, what are the factors of 12?
The factors of a number are the numbers that divide evenly into the number. For example the factors of the number 12 are the numbers 1, 2, 3, 4, 6 and 12.
Furthermore, how many positive factors does 12 have? So 1, 2, 3, 4, 6 and 12 are factors of 12.
Besides, what are proper factors?
A proper factor of a positive integer is a factor of other than 1 or. (Derbyshire 2004, p. 32). For example, 2 and 3 are positive proper factors of 6, but 1 and 6 are not.
What are the factors of 12 least to greatest?
In order, from least to greatest, the factors of 12 are 1, 2, 3, 4, 6, and 12.
